There are more than a dozen collaboration boards shipping now. And, nearly all of them have a proprietary software OS. Not Avocor.  Avocor, the start-up out of Portland, Washington, decided to use Windows 10 to allow for the Microsoft suite of applications to be used on any Avocor board. And, since it’s designed for touch, the Windows interface lends itself well to a giant tablet-like form-factor that comes in a plethora of sizes – most of which are native 4K (3840 x 2160 resolution).
